muvee autoProducer DVD Edition Awarded 4 Stars by PC Magazine
Fast, fun and easy video editing software lets anyone automatically create their own MTV-style videos in a snap
Singapore –– April 30, 2003 – muvee Technologies, the pioneer in smart automatic video production, today announced that its groundbreaking video editing software, muvee autoProducer DVD Edition, has received a four-star rating from leading technology publication, PC Magazine.
The review, by PC Magazine’s Contributing Editor, Jan Ozer, appears in the May 6, 2003 issue of the publication, and is available online at www.pcmag.com/article2/0,4149,1020102,00.asp.
“Imagine that you could hire an MTV video producer to edit your vacation video or other family footage and synchronize it to your favorite music. That, in a nutshell, is the premise behind muvee autoProducer DVD Edition,” said Ozer. “We tested with different videos, including footage from Zoo Atlanta and shots from a seminar. The Zoo Atlanta results were fantastic…It’s a fun tool to have on your DV workbench.”

muvee autoProducer DVD Edition features an uncluttered and user-friendly interface with only six key buttons. Users input raw video in AVI, MPEG-1 or MPEG-2 file formats, or they can capture directly from a digital camcorder via FireWire. They can then add WAV or MP3 music, before selecting a style from the program’s built-in list of 24, each with its own unique set of effects and transitions. There is also an option to include a title and end credits. muvee autoProducer then analyzes all these elements before automatically editing the raw footage to the length of the music, complete with effects and transitions based on the chosen style, timed in sync to the rhythm of the music. The finished muvee can then be saved in a variety of different formats, including MPEG-2 for SVCD- or DVD-creation.

About muvee Technologies
Founded in 2001, muvee Technologies is a privately held company headquartered in Singapore. The company’s flagship product, muvee autoProducer, is the world’s first smart automatic video production software for the PC. Underlying the program’s simple six-button interface is pioneering technology that dramatically simplifies the video creation process, enabling anyone to automatically and easily create high quality finished productions from raw video, hundreds – even thousands – of times faster than any other approach.
muvee autoProducer has been awarded “Designed for Windows XP” certification from Microsoft®, and is currently sold in retail outlets in North America, Europe, Southeast Asia and Japan. To date, muvee autoProducer has also sold into 60 countries worldwide directly from the company’s website at www.muvee.com.
muvee Technologies currently has three pending patents for its innovations in smart automatic video production, and has showcased its groundbreaking technology at leading industry events such as COMDEX in the US, CeBIT in Germany, and Japan’s WPC Expo.
